Abstract

The formulae are given for the Fourier transforms of a number of helical structures; namely, a thin helical wire, a set of identical atoms spaced at regular intervals on a helix, and the general case of a group of atoms repeated by the operation of a non-integer screw. General predictions are made concerning the intensities of the X-ray diffraction pattern of the synthetic polypeptide poly-7-methyl-L-glutamate, assuming that its structure is based on the a-helix suggested by Pauling & Corey.
